About the beauty and pitfalls of nonlinear nature and the value of early-career networks - Tommaso Alberti and Beatrice Ellerhoff

7/20/2021
Nonlinear behavior is by no means a negative thing. Ubiquitous in nature, it can be found in the response of climate to warming, in the dynamics of the solar wind, and in the spread of pandemics. In this episode, Tommaso Alberti invites everybody to marvel at the beauty of nonlinearities in nature - and to better understand them mathematically. Light-matter interaction - arriving early and late at the same time - Martin Hayhurst Appel and Beatrice Ellerhoff

5/10/2021
Light-matter interaction plays a part in many areas of physics from macroscopic stars to the microscopic quantum world. This episode is devoted to the fascinating interactions that occur when a few particles of light (photons) couple to tiny fragments of matter (quantum dots). Martin Hayhurst Appel, PhD candidate in Copenhagen, explores how the strange light-matter interaction can be used to transport quantum information. Building a quantum simulator from scratch and the coolest moment in life - Helene Hainzer and Beatrice Ellerhoff

3/24/2021
Here comes the second part of our quantum simulation special: Helene Hainzer (IQOQI Innsbruck) shares with us how to plan and set up a new quantum experiment, what two-dimensional crystals are, and how to use them to perform an analog quantum simulation. We talk about the prospects of quantum simulation and the curiosity-driven side of fundamental sciences, the coolest moment in life, and artistic passions. How to quantum simulate exotic materials and build a scientific career - Fabian Grusdt with Ella Crane and Alex Schuckert

3/15/2021
Some of the most exotic materials found in the last decades still defy an explanation for their unusual properties, including high-temperature superconductors, materials which can conduct electricity without loss and the need to cool to close to absolute zero. Quantum precision, taking risks and collaborating with friends - Asier Pineiro-Orioli and Alexander Schuckert

12/23/2020
How can we use the laws of quantum physics to build more precise measurement devices? Apart from this question, Asier Piñeiro Orioli and Alexander Schuckert, also discuss about their experiences as young researchers in quantum science, how taking risks is elementary to progress and why it is crucial to work with friends rather than colleagues.
